GENERAL INFORMATION



THE PROPERTY





Sitting on the popular Weston Park Avenue, this attractive end-terrace house is now available for sale with no upward chain. Built in 1994, this well-presented property boasts a generous 958 square feet of living space, making it an ideal family home.



Upon entering, you are greeted by an entrance hall that leads into a bright and airy dual aspect lounge diner. The fitted kitchen, conveniently located adjacent to the dining area, features a door that opens directly into the garden.



The first floor comprises three well-proportioned bedrooms, providing ample space for a family or guests, along with a family bathroom. The property has been recently redecorated in neutral tones, ensuring a fresh, clean feel throughout, complemented by gas central heating and double glazing for comfort and efficiency.



Externally, the property benefits from a driveway that leads to an integral garage with an up-and-over door, offering parking for two vehicles. A pathway runs alongside the house, leading to a fully enclosed rear garden that provides a space for outdoor activities, gardening, or simply enjoying the fresh air.



This delightful home is perfectly situated in a popular area, making it an excellent choice for those seeking a blend of comfort and convenience. With its appealing features and no upward chain, this property is not to be missed.



LOCATION
Weston Park Avenue is a popular location, close to canal walks and local amenities. The A38 is a short drive away, leading to the A50, providing quick access to Derby, Uttoxeter, and Lichfield.

ACCOMMODATION

Entrance door opening through to hallway.

HALLWAY

Has a door to the front aspect, window to the side aspect, ceiling light point and door opening through to lounge and dining area.

LOUNGE AND DINING AREA

Has a window to the front aspect, further window to the rear aspect, radiator, ceiling light points, door to kitchen, door to stairs and a feature fire surround with tiled inset,

KITCHEN

There is a door to the garden, window looking out to the rear garden, the kitchen is fitted with a range of base cupboards, drawers and wall mounted cabinets, worktops incorporate a four ring gas hob and a one and a quarter composite sink with mixer tap, there is an integrated Bosch oven, the Ideal Logic domestic hot water and central heating boiler is housed here, there are attractive tiled surrounds, radiator and ceiling light point.

FIRST FLOOR

Has a window and turns to the main landing.

LANDING

Has a loft access point, radiator and a useful built in storage cupboard which also houses the domestic hot water and central heating tank and offers space for linen storage. Doors lead off:

BEDROOM ONE

Has a window to the front aspect, radiator and ceiling light point.

BEDROOM TWO

Has a window to the rear apsect, radiator and ceiling light point.

BEDROOM THREE

Has a window to the front aspect, radiator and ceiling light point.

FAMILY BATHROOM

Has a panelled bath with taps, a separate electric Mira shower over, corner pedestal hand wash basin, W.C., there are radiators, tiled splashbacks, window to the rear aspect and ceiling light point.

OUTSIDE

The property sits back off Weston Park Avenue and provides parking for two vehicles, there is a garage with up and over door and to the side of the property is a path that leads through to the fully enclosed rear garden which has fenced boundary, lawn, patio and gravel and shrub borders.
